Transaction 689493e0c8e5a7fa5d53ae08bb9ab0456fd043e97da249c925c2a6f7606af292
1 Input
1 Output
-
689493e0c8e5a7fa5d53ae08bb9ab0456fd043e97da249c925c2a6f7606af292:0
- value
- 398970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d29552a5061260827d16106f3a656b49eed3a2 OP_EQUAL
- address
- 32x6ycyzirfithh3CgqxaCWo2bVdJafHjU